Short answer riviera beach city: Riviera Beach is a coastal city in Palm Beach County, Florida. It has a population of approximately 35,000 and boasts scenic beaches, marinas, and parks. The Port of Palm Beach is located within its boundaries and serves as a major economic center for the area.

Visit Peanut Island
One of the must-visit attractions when you’re in Riviera Beach is Peanut Island. This 80-acre barrier island was created by dredging operations for the Port of Palm Beach and has since become a favorite spot among locals and tourists alike.
There are plenty of recreational activities available including snorkeling, fishing, kayaking or paddleboarding in crystal clear waters.
